The Opportunity:

Under the supervision of the Director of Technology Transfer and with a dotted line to the Principal Investigator for the UCF Accelerating Research Translation (ART) Program, the Assistant Director for Technology Transfer and Entrepreneurship plays a pivotal role in managing all activities under the ART Program and its central component, the UCF Venture Lab, with the overarching goal of meeting the following Program objectives:

  • Strengthen and sustain the institutional infrastructure that translates research to the marketplace by creating a Venture Lab.

  • Offer educational and training opportunities that train individuals (especially graduate students and postdoctoral fellows) to become entrepreneurs or pursue translation-research-oriented careers.

  • Support specific seed translational research projects (STRPs) to create economic and societal impact and diversity research translation.

  • Create, expand, and sustain a network of ART Ambassadors to support innovation and research translation.

Responsibilities:

  • Coordinate and manage a continuum of entrepreneurial support services for graduate students, postdoctoral fellows, faculty, and staff, including entrepreneurship education, business opportunity assessment and validation, startup company formation, management team recruitment, and business development and growth.

  • Oversee the Entrepreneur-in-Residence mentoring/coaching program under the Venture Lab.

  • Assist in managing the UCF ART budget and personnel and annual reports to NSF; track, monitor, analyze, and report to internal and external stakeholders on activities, progress, and impact of the ART Program and Venture Lab.

  • Plan, organize, and execute ART Program and Venture Lab events.

  • Coordinate promotion, marketing, and recruitment of students, postdoctoral fellows, and faculty to participate in ART and Venture Lab.

  • Assist with the planning and executing process for the competitive selection of STRPs for funding.

  • Develop and maintain relationships with industry, investor, and entrepreneur communities to create and expand a network of innovation supporters, who will serve as ART Ambassadors.

  • Curate content and materials on innovation, research translation, and entrepreneurship to create, maintain, and expand the collection of resources for researcher entrepreneurs.

  • Other duties as assigned.
